Ingredients
– 2 pounds of medium-sized potatoes (preferably Yukon gold or red)
– 1 cup ranch dressing
– ½ cup mayonnaise
– 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
– ½ cup diced celery
– ½ cup diced red onion
– ½ cup cooked bacon, crumbled (optional)
– ¼ cup chopped green onions
– 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
– Salt and black p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)
Instructions
Creating the perfect Ranch Potato Salad involves easy steps. Follow these straightforward instructions to achieve delicious results:
1. Boil the Potatoes: Start by placing the potatoes in a large pot and covering them with water. Add salt to the water and bring to a boil. Cook until fork-tender, about 15-20 minutes.
2. Drain and Cool: Once the potatoes are cooked, drain them and let them cool for about 10 minutes. This will make them easier to handle.
3. Dice the Potatoes: Cut the cooled potatoes into bite-sized cubes. You can peel them if desired, but skins add texture and flavor.
4. Prepare Dressing: In a mixing bowl, combine the ranch dressing,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, apple cider vinegar, and a pinch of salt and black pepper. Whisk until smooth and creamy.
5. Combine Ingredients: In a large bowl, add the diced potatoes, celery, red onion, crumbled bacon (if using), and chopped green onions. Gently fold in the dressing mixture, ensuring all ingredients are well coated.
6. Chill: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 20 minutes to allow flavors to meld together. If time permits, chilling for a few hours improves the taste.
7. Garnish and Serve: Before serving, give the salad a gentle stir. Adjust seasoning as necessary. Garnish with fresh parsley, and enjoy!
